We have a beautiful forested mountain that sits at the southern edge of the GreenRidge State Forest. We sit on top of the Paw Paw tunnel and have access to the C and O Canal Trail. We view this place has nature's forest that we are stewards of. We are reclaiming this land that was clear cut over a hundred years ago for an apple orchard and then used as a sawmill and car dump. We have a beautiful deciduous and pine forest with an incredible scenic mountain top that can view the Potomac River at one end. Each day we are working the land to create a beautiful back to nature spot for campers, hikers, bikers, river and travel enthusiasts. Currently we are suited for being a “bring all your stuff with you” camping as we are completely off grid.

Great, secluded spot on top of the hill. Tight trail to drive up to the camp, you're not going to make it in a passenger car, 4x4 with clearance is necessary. The site is a good size. Great spot for hammock camping. If you're in a tent, finding a flat spot might be more challenging, but doable. The porta-john was an easy walk down the trail to the other campsite and luckily no one was there when I needed to use it. It's definitely due for an emptying! Plenty of firewood and kindling to be found, bring something to split it. The stars were beautiful. Had whippoorwills singing to me in the evening and morning. Throughout the night you can hear dogs and other animals, but no sign that any animals visited camp. I hiked from camp to the tunnel trail and followed the tunnel detour signs to do a complete loop through the tunnel. Be sure to take a flashlight (not just your phone). It's super dark in there. I had a little trouble finding the place because my GPS brought me in from the opposite direction, but eventually found it, but an address would have been helpful. Overall a great place to camp and I'm looking forward to returning.
